ASA 1 - answer-Healthy non-smoking, normal BMI pt

ASA 2 - answer-- Pt with mild diseases but well controlled
- May be a current smoker
- BMI 30-40

ASA 3 - answer-Pt with severe systemic disease

ASA 4 - answer-Pt with a disease that is constant threat to life

ASA 5 - answer-Pt not expected to survive without the planned surgery

ASA 6 - answer-Brain-dead pt waiting for organ harvest

Assault - answer-The pt fears they may be harmed due to intentional actions of staff

Battery - answer-Touching the pt without consent

BiPAP - answer-- Delivers PEEP, pressure support times breaths
- Reacts to changes in breathing
- Non-invasive equivalent to a vent

Blended care - answer-- Care of pts who belong in multiple phases of care

, - Clinical judgement is required to determine safe staffing
- Pts in different levels may share same physical space
- An effort must be made to ensure privacy and confidentiality

Brachial plexus - answer-- Block of spinal nerves from C5-T1 vertebrae
- Each bundle divides and eventually end in radial, ulnar, and median nerves
- Used for hand, forearm, and shoulder surgeries
- Interscalene, supraclavicular, infraclavicular, axillary

Braden scale - answer-- Tool to determine pressure sore risks
- Moisture, activity, nutrition, friction/shear, sensory perception

Capnography - answer-- Can detect early hypoxia to allow correction of
hypoventilation, apnea, or airway obstruction
- Can be used in areas other than operating rooms for procedures or peripheral
nerve blocks
- Can increase safety for pts when included with use of pulse ox
- O2 supplementation may correct for pulse ox readings but may mask
hypoventilation

CPAP - answer-Delivers PEEP, delivers constant pressure
